4.4.7 SPI
4.4.7.1 SPI0
SPI boot not supported
Name
Pin #
Description
I/O
Type
I/O
Level
Power
Domain
PU / PD
Comments
SPI0_CS0#
P43
SPI0 Master Chip Select 0
O CMOS
1.8V
Standby
This signal can be used to select carrier SPI as
boot device
SPI0_CS1#
P31
SPI0 Master Chip Select 1
O CMOS
1.8V
Standby
SPI0_CK
P44
SPI0 Clock
O CMOS
1.8V
Standby
SPI0_DIN
P45
SPI0 Master input / Slave output
I CMOS
1.8V
Standby
also referred to as MISO
SPI0_DO
P46
SPI0 Master output / Slave input
O CMOS
1.8V
Standby
also referred to as MOSI
4.4.7.2 SPI1
SPI Mode
Name
Pin #
Description
I/O
Type
I/O
Level
Power
Domain
PU / PD
Comments
SPI1_CS0#
P45
SPI1 Master Chip Select 0
O
CMOS
1.8V
Standby
This signal can be used to select carrier SPI as boot
device. can also be used as ESPI_CS0#
SPI1_CS1#
P55
SPI1 Master Chip Select 1
O
CMOS
1.8V
Standby
can also be used as ESPI_CS1#
SPI1_CK
P56
SPI1 Clock
O CMOS
1.8V
Standby
can also be used as ESPI_CK
SPI1_DIN
P57
SPI1 Master input / Slave output
I CMOS
1.8V
Standby
also referred to as MISO can also be used as
ESPI_IO_1
SPI1_DO
P58
SPI1 Master output / Slave input
O CMOS
1.8V
Standby
also referred to as MOSI can also be used as
ESPI_IO_0
